在当今快速发展的金融市场中,获取准确、实时的财经数据对于投资者来说至关重要。这不仅可以帮助他们做出明智的投资决策,还可以在市场波动中把握时机。本文将详细介绍如何轻松获取精准投资信息,包括数据来源、调用方式以及数据分析方法。

一、数据来源

1. 官方渠道

  • 证券交易所:如上海证券交易所、深圳证券交易所等,提供股票、债券等金融产品的交易数据。
  • 金融监管机构:如中国人民银行、中国证监会等,发布宏观经济、金融政策等数据。
  • 行业协会:如中国基金业协会、中国证券业协会等,提供行业统计数据。

2. 第三方数据服务商

  • 金融信息服务机构:如东方财富、同花顺等,提供股票、基金、债券等金融产品的数据服务。
  • 大数据平台:如百度金融云、阿里云等,提供各类金融数据服务。

3. 自建数据库

部分大型金融机构会建立自己的数据库,用于内部分析和决策。

二、数据调用方式

1. API接口

许多数据服务商提供API接口,方便用户调用所需数据。以下是一些常见的API接口:

  • 股票数据:股票代码、实时价格、成交量、涨跌幅等。
  • 基金数据:基金代码、净值、基金经理、投资组合等。
  • 债券数据:债券代码、利率、到期日、信用评级等。

2. 数据爬虫

对于部分免费或开放的数据,用户可以使用数据爬虫技术获取。但需注意,数据爬虫要遵循相关法律法规和网站政策。

3. 数据可视化工具

部分数据服务商提供数据可视化工具,方便用户直观地查看和分析数据。

三、数据分析方法

1. 时间序列分析

分析历史数据,预测未来趋势。如移动平均线、指数平滑等。

2. 因子分析

找出影响投资收益的关键因素,如宏观经济指标、政策导向等。

3. 聚类分析

将相似的投资产品或投资者进行分类,以便更好地进行研究和投资。

4. 机器学习

利用机器学习算法,对大量数据进行挖掘和分析,发现潜在的投资机会。

四、案例分析

以下以东方财富API为例,展示如何调用股票数据:

import requests

def get_stock_data(stock_code):
    url = f"https://api.eastmoney.com/EM_FinanceApi/api/JiaRuiApi/JiaRuiIndex?token=你的token&code={stock_code}"
    response = requests.get(url)
    data = response.json()
    return data

stock_code = '600519'  # 招商银行股票代码
data = get_stock_data(stock_code)
print(data)

五、总结

轻松获取精准投资信息,需要掌握数据来源、调用方式以及数据分析方法。通过合理运用这些技术和工具,投资者可以更好地把握市场动态,做出明智的投资决策。